AZ SB1298 poses an imminent threat to online freedom in Arizona. This bill mandates commercial entities to verify users accessing content deemed "harmful to minors," potentially leading to censorship, particularly impacting queer and trans content. Violations of this law could result in severe penalties, including court costs and attorney's fees.

Key Points:

  • Urgent Threat to Online Freedom: SB1298 could restrict access to diverse content online, stifling free expression.
  • Potential for Censorship: Vague criteria for "harmful material" leave room for subjective interpretation, risking censorship of legitimate speech.
  • Severe Penalties for Non-Compliance: Entities face significant liabilities for violations, including court costs and attorney's fees.
